Health Rehabilitation for Pink Dogs

Medical stabilization is a top priority in pink dog animal rescue, addressing parasites, malnutrition, and untreated injuries. Shelters work with volunteer veterinarians to create low-cost treatment plans that increase survival rates.

Transport teams coordinate across regions to bring dogs to specialized facilities when local resources are limited. Standardized intake forms help track medical histories, ensuring continuity of care from rescue to recovery.

Behavioral Training and Socialization

Many pink dogs entering rescues have experienced limited human contact, requiring gentle desensitization and basic obedience training. Positive reinforcement methods build confidence and make dogs more appealing to potential families.

Group play sessions and structured walks reduce stress in kennels, while volunteer handlers document progress to match dogs with suitable adopters. Consistent routines help translate learned behaviors into home environments after adoption.

Community Engagement and Fundraising

Visual branding in pink drives online campaigns, merchandise sales, and local events that generate critical funding for emergency veterinary care. Transparent reporting on how donations are used builds trust and encourages recurring support.

Partnerships with pet supply retailers provide discounted food and toys, while corporate sponsors host adoption days that connect dogs with busy professionals and families. Storytelling through photos and updates keeps supporters emotionally invested in each dog’s journey.

Adoption Process and Long-Term Support

Adoption coordinators review applications, conduct home checks, and schedule meet-and-greets to ensure compatibility between pink dogs and their new families. Post-adoption follow-ups, including training tips and wellness reminders, reduce the likelihood of returns.

Some rescues offer trial periods and ongoing mentorship, helping first-time owners navigate challenges such as house-training, separation anxiety, and dietary adjustments. This layered support model strengthens lifetime commitments and improves overall success rates.

How can I start a pink dog animal rescue in my area?

Begin by connecting with established municipal shelters, mapping local foster capacity, and outlining basic medical protocols. Secure seed funding through community events and crowdfunding, then build a volunteer base trained in handling, transport, and visitor engagement.

What are the typical costs to care for a pink dog before adoption? Expect expenses for spay/neuter, vaccinations, parasite control, microchipping, and grooming, often ranging from $200 to $500 per dog. Transport and emergency vet care can add to costs, so budgeting for a reserve fund and pursuing recurring donors is essential. How do rescues screen adopters for pink dogs specifically?

Applications review housing type, prior pet experience, daily routine, and motivation for choosing a pink dog. Interviews and home checks assess compatibility, while reference checks and signed agreements outline responsibilities around care, training, and veterinary decisions.

What happens if a pink dog is returned after adoption?

Rescues usually maintain a return policy that allows the dog to come back without judgment, followed by re-assessment and additional support such as training consultations or behavior consultations. The goal is to preserve animal welfare and find a lasting match rather than penalizing the adopter.
